Elizabeth DeMartinoMy family fled Prussia in 1881 or so. They said Kaiser Wilhelm took their castle, on the Oder River. The town was called Bromberg. How can I research if the castle even remains and what happened back then?
ipflohi,

Bromberg is now known as Bydgoszcz in Poland. It was a big city in the province of Posen. As far as I know there was no big castle or mansion in the city.

EdwardLeksykon Zamkow W Polsce

Which I take it means 'Castles in Poland' ?

Does have on page 119 a picture of an
old print of the castle there. Though
from the print it looks more like a
fortified house.
There is some decent detail there with
plenty of dates.
But as it is all in Polish!
Earlist date mentioned is 1343;
and the latest is 1895.
